









Our grain mill grinder is equipped with a 3000W pure copper motor, operates at 1400 r/min, and grinds 100 kilograms (220 lbs) of material every hour. Thanks to the pure copper winding motor, this grinder outperforms lower-wattage options like 2200W models. It processes larger batches of grains, spices, and feeds quickly while consistently delivering uniform results.
The output capacity of this grinder makes it suitable for commercial kitchens, feed processing enterprises, or small mills that need to meet consistent, high-volume demand. The body of this commercial grain mill grinder is made of high quality stainless steel, with a smooth interior to prevent powder from sticking to the walls. This fine finish allows materials to flow through the grinding chamber rather than accumulate and clog the system during long grinding cycles, helping to maintain stable throughput batch after batch.
Stainless steel construction also gives the device exceptional resistance to corrosion and rust, allowing it to withstand years of frequent usage in kitchens or processing plants. It is easy to wipe down and clean between batches, which helps maintain acceptable hygiene standards for food-related grinding tasks. Inside the grinding chamber, two sturdy grinding discs work in conjunction with three stainless steel scrapers on a rotating axle, which reduces the material to a fine, even powder. The scrapers help move material across the disc surface, reducing the likelihood of accumulation that could impede processing or produce uneven results across a full batch. In addition, the design allows the grinder to grind both hard and soft substances in a single pass.

The fineness adjustment lets the user set the grind from 0 to 50 mesh, covering textures from coarser to finer powder, depending on the material being processed. Turn the knob anti-clockwise for a coarser grind and clockwise for a finer grind to tighten the spacing between the discs. This setting is good for spices or flour. This range serves most domestic and small commercial needs, from coarse cornmeal to fine wheat flour.

The grain mill grinder has a large-capacity, food-grade stainless steel hopper on top, which means you won’t have to reload the machine as often during a grinding run. The hopper is easy to clean and fill, and a blanking valve underneath puts users in control of feeding rate and pace as material travels into the grinding chamber below.
A built-in magnetic device at the outlet captures any iron fragments produced during grinding. This feature keeps your ground powder free from metal contamination, promoting better cleanliness. If the machine is pushed beyond its operating capability, an overload protector engages immediately, cutting power to prevent the motor from being damaged. Together, these characteristics help ensure safer, cleaner operation during everyday use.
